WebMar 21, 2024 · Dr. Ridker's November 2002 study comparing C-reactive protein and LDL found that cardiovascular risk was actually greater for people in the high CRP/low LDL group than for those in the low CRP/high LDL group. Clearly, cholesterol testing would have missed people in the high CRP/low LDL group.
